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1406 9116057150 06
7023985233 90947503185 48984640780
7023985233 90947503185 48984640780
419080 147 0234166
All about undefined
Interested in learning more?
7023985233 90947503185 48984640780
419080 147 0234166
See more
199783401 75289 30000041
918 6927922 88228 75116493858 6560043695
See more
922285 32210502
80 718 41804
See more